Taxila

The ancient settlement of Taxila in the western outskirts of the twin cities of and is a UNESCO World Heritage Site; it is considered one of the most important archaeological sites of South Asia, and for good reason.

is the name of an archaeological site on the bank opposite to the city of , Punjab, . The city of was built by the Greco-Bactrian king Demetrius after he invaded modern-day around 180 BC. is situated 1 km southwest of Taxila.

The , also referred to as the Great Stupa of Taxila, is a Buddhist near Taxila, Pakistan. It was built over the relics of the Buddha by Ashoka, the Emperor of , in the 3rd century BCE. is situated 1½ km south of Taxila.

The is an archaeological site in Taxila in the Punjab province of . It contains some of the oldest ruins of Ancient Taxila, dated to sometime around the period 800–525 BC as its earliest layers bear "grooved" Red Burnished Ware, the , along with several other nearby excavations, form part of the Ruins of Taxila – inscribed as a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1980.
